Cingular adds 657,000 customers
By Jeffry Bartash, CBS.MarketWatch.com
Last Update: 8:58 AM ET Oct. 20, 2004



WASHINGTON (CBS.MW) -- Cingular on Wednesday said it added the most customers in more than a year, helping to drive third-quarter sales 5 percent higher.

The company, a joint venture of BellSouth (BLS: news, chart, profile) and SBC Communications (SBC: news, chart, profile), added a net 657,000 subscribers to bring its total to 25.7 million. It was the strongest performance since the third quarter of 2003.

Yet to boost subscriber growth in the intensely competitive wireless business, Cingular had to spend more to sign them up. Operating expenses climbed 6.3 percent to $3.8 billion.

Sales, on the other hand, rose a lesser 4.9 percent -- to $4.3 billion from $4.06 billion.

The company said future results are likely to include AT&T Wireless (AWE: news, chart, profile), which Cingular is set to acquire. Federal regulators could grant approval of the $40 billion merger within a month.

"Soon, we expect to receive approvals and close the AT&T Wireless transaction," Cingular Chief Executive Stan Sigman said. "[O]ur number one focus will be giving customers great service and a seamless transition."

During the quarter, customer churn registered 2.8 percent, the same as the year-ago period but up from 2.7 percent in the prior quarter. Churn reflects how many customers switch or terminate service.

Monthly revenue per user, a key measure of industry success, fell 5.1 percent from the year-earlier period to $49.78. It was down a lesser 1.1 percent from the prior quarter.

The amount that Cingular customers pay per month for wireless service is among the lowest in the industry. The acquisition of AT&T Wireless will help boost that number because it caters to more business clients. Cingular has a greater share of the consumer market.

AT&T Wireless, however, has had problems holding on to customers amid technological snafus and other problems. Its churn rate reached 3.7 percent in the third quarter, a sharply higher rate of turnover than its competitors. Monthly revenue per use fell to $57.40 from $61.20 in the year-ago quarter.

By contrast, Sprint (FON: news, chart, profile) generated $63 in revenue per user each month during the third quarter while keeping churn down to 2.7 percent.

Industry leader Verizon Wireless, meanwhile, reported a company-low churn rate of 1.45 percent in the second quarter, with each user spending $50.80 per month on wireless service. Like Cingular, Verizon has a big consumer audience, but they tend not to move around as much.

It also has to do with their sharp drop in prices. In order to slow down customer defections AWS had to slash prices everywhere and basically put themselves out for clearance. Many people simply have changed to these new plans which are much cheaper than last year's.

Remember how AT&T national plans were only on their network which was much poorer back then and did not have M2M, and charged a lot for roaming? Well, all those mistakes were slowly taken care of during 2004.
